// Localization routines
/**
* The locale to look for string bundles if none are defined for your locale. Translations for all strings
* should be provided in this locale.
*/
//TODO: this really belongs in translation metadata, not in code
dojo.fallback_locale = 'en';
/**
* Returns canonical form of locale, as used by Dojo. All variants are case-insensitive and are separated by '-'
* as specified in RFC 3066
*/
dojo.normalizeLocale = function(locale) {
return locale ? locale.toLowerCase() : dojo.locale;
};
/**
* requireLocalization() is for loading translated bundles provided within a package in the namespace.
* Contents are typically strings, but may be any name/value pair, represented in JSON format.
* A bundle is structured in a program as follows:
*
* <package>/
* nls/
* de/
* mybundle.js
* de-at/
* mybundle.js
* en/
* mybundle.js
* en-us/
* mybundle.js
* en-gb/
* mybundle.js
* es/
* mybundle.js
* ...etc
*
* where package is part of the namespace as used by dojo.require(). Each directory is named for a
* locale as specified by RFC 3066, (http://www.ietf.org/rfc/rfc3066.txt), normalized in lowercase.
*
* For a given locale, string bundles will be loaded for that locale and all general locales above it, as well
* as a system-specified fallback. For example, "de_at" will also load "de" and "en". Lookups will traverse
* the locales in this order. A build step can preload the bundles to avoid data redundancy and extra network hits.
*
* @param modulename package in which the bundle is found
* @param bundlename bundle name, typically the filename without the '.js' suffix
* @param locale the locale to load (optional) By default, the browser's user locale as defined
* in dojo.locale
*/
